**Ticket: Quillmap prefetcher fetching tiles outside allowlist**

The Quillmap prefetcher requests tiles from origins not on the configured allowlist when a style file includes external sprite references. Patch restricts fetches to approved hosts and drops credentials on redirects. Needs security sign-off before release. Repro and fix validated in the staging build identified by the token below.

build token for yajof-bajof: htk31_506ff1188f74596b5bb2eec94edc43c

## CI Troubleshooting — TumbleKey Access Flow

New folks: if the TumbleKey laundry-locker access tests fail in CI, it's usually one of two things. First, the mock kiosk container sometimes starts slowly, so the access-grant handshake times out — rerun the stage once before digging deeper. Second, expired test credentials in the fixtures cause silent 403s; regenerate them with the refresh script in the tools folder. If failures persist after both fixes, pull the full pipeline log and match it against the trace token printed below.

session token of taduf-yagug = htk4_5ec8

Heads up: if the Gaugeworks sidecar fails health checks in CI, it's almost always the aggregation window config, not the sidecar itself. The test harness spins it up with a 5s flush interval, and slow runners miss the first scrape. Bump the startup grace period before blaming the image. Also check that the fixture metrics port isn't already claimed by a leaked process. When filing a flake report, include the trace token shown below.

pipeline stamp: htk4_ae36